零基础微信小程序开发——页面事件之下拉刷新事件(保姆级教程+超详细)

下拉刷新事件什么是下拉刷新?

下拉刷新是设备上的一种专有名词和操作方式。它指的是用户通过手指在屏幕上的下拉滑动操作,从而触发页面数据的重新加载。在小程序中的应用:

在小程序中,下拉刷新是一个常见的页面事件。它允许用户在不离开当前页面的情况下,通过简单的下拉动作来更新页面内容

当用户在小程序页面中执行下拉操作时,系统会检测到这一行为并触发下拉刷新事件。此时,小程序者可以编写相应的代码来处理这个事件。例如,从服务器获取最新的数据并更新到页面上。这样,用户就可以在不离开当前页面的情况下,获取到最新的信息。下拉刷新的优势:

下拉刷新功能不仅提高了用户体验,还使得数据更新变得更加便捷和高效。它允许用户在不中断当前操作的情况下,轻松地获取最新的数据和信息。

在小程序中,合理利用下拉刷新事件可以显著提升应用的交互性和实用性。它为用户提供了一个简单而直观的方式来更新页面内容,从而增强了应用的可用性和吸引力。启用下拉刷新全局开启下拉刷新

全局开启下拉刷新意味着在整个小程序的所有页面中,下拉刷新功能都将被启用。要实现这一点,你需要在.文件的节点中,将属性设置为。

虽然全局开启下拉刷新方便快捷,但它可能并不总是符合实际需求。因为在实际应用中,可能只有部分页面需要下拉刷新功能。局部开启下拉刷新

为了解决全局开启下拉刷新带来的问题,小程序提供了局部开启下拉刷新的方式。这种方式允许你为特定的页面单独开启下拉刷新功能。

要实现局部开启下拉刷新,你需要在目标页面的.配置文件中,将属性设置为。

通过这种方式,你可以精确控制哪些页面需要下拉刷新功能,从而提高用户体验和应用性能。案例

我们做一个案例演示,演示一下局部开启下拉刷新,我将在.页面开启下拉刷新,然后通过.页面点击按钮跳转到.页面,但是.页面没有开启下拉刷新

.文件:

给.文件配置可下拉刷新配置,那么.页面就可以下拉,不影响其他页面

.文件:

给.文件配置下拉刷新配置,那么.页面就不可以下拉刷新,不影响其他页面配置下拉更新窗口样式

在小程序中,下拉刷新事件是一个常见的用户交互功能,它允许用户通过下拉屏幕来刷新当前页面的内容。为了提升用户体验,者可以自定义下拉刷新窗口的样式,使其更加符合应用的风格和主题。

配置下拉刷新窗口的样式

要配置下拉刷新窗口的样式,你需要在全局或页面的.配置文件中进行如下设置:暗色加载样式和白色背景

这个配置将下拉刷新窗口的背景颜色设置为白色,加载过程中的样式为暗色。适合用于浅色主题的应用。

亮色加载样式和黑色背景

这个配置将下拉刷新窗口的背景颜色设置为黑色,加载过程中的样式为亮色。适合用于深色主题的应用。蓝色背景和中性色加载样式注意事项监听页面的下拉刷新事件

在页面的 . 文件中,通过 () 函数即可监听当前页面的下拉刷新事件。

案例:

现在我们尝试做一个案例,做一个点击事件,在页面上设置一个按钮和文本,文本中展示变量的值,当点击按钮的值就会自增+1,下拉刷新之后的值就会清零

.文件:

设置一个按钮,给按钮绑定一个事件,点击按钮即可触发事件,并且展示一段本分,用来显示变量的值

.文件:

开启下拉刷新配置,主要是设置 “”:

.文件:

首先定义一个变量,默认值为0,然后捕捉_事件,当事件触发之后,让当前变量的值自增+1,然后使用方法捕捉到页面进行了下拉刷新,然后将变量的值变为0

© 版权声明
THE END
分享